Randall Kato, a beloved member of his community and an accomplished business owner, passed away peacefully on September 18, 2025, in Hinesville, Georgia, at the age of 66. Born on October 10, 1958, in Wahiawa, Hawaii, Randall's life was marked by a deep passion for both his career and personal pursuits.
Randall was the owner of Kato’s Floor Covering, where he dedicated countless hours to building a successful business that served many families and businesses in his community. His work ethic and commitment to quality left a lasting impact on all those he served.
Beyond his professional achievements, Randall was a man of many interests and passions. An avid baseball player from a young age, he showcased his exceptional talent on the field. He was a standout player on the first Wahiawa Little League Team to participate in the Little League World Series in 1971. In addition to baseball, Randall enjoyed dirt bike riding during his teenage years and was a longtime competitor in surfing and paddleboarding competitions. Randall’s military service in the U.S. Army exemplified his dedication to his country.
